网络监控方案的关键技术有哪些?
随着互联网技术的飞速发展,网络安全问题日益突出,网络监控作为保障网络安全的重要手段,其重要性不言而喻。本文将深入探讨网络监控方案的关键技术,旨在为广大读者提供有益的参考。
一、入侵检测技术
入侵检测技术是网络监控的核心技术之一,其主要功能是实时监控网络流量,识别并报警潜在的安全威胁。以下是几种常见的入侵检测技术:
基于特征的入侵检测技术:通过分析网络流量中的特征,如IP地址、端口号、协议类型等,识别恶意攻击行为。
基于行为的入侵检测技术:通过分析用户或系统的行为模式,识别异常行为,进而发现潜在的安全威胁。
基于机器学习的入侵检测技术:利用机器学习算法,对网络流量进行分类,识别未知攻击。
二、数据包捕获技术
数据包捕获技术是网络监控的基础,通过对网络数据包的实时捕获和分析,可以了解网络运行状况,发现潜在的安全问题。以下是几种常见的数据包捕获技术:
原始套接字捕获技术:通过操作系统的原始套接字接口,直接捕获网络数据包。
网络接口捕获技术:通过操作系统提供的网络接口,捕获网络数据包。
第三方捕获工具:如Wireshark等,通过分析捕获到的数据包,识别网络异常。
三、日志分析技术
日志分析技术是网络监控的重要手段,通过对系统日志、网络设备日志等进行分析,可以发现潜在的安全威胁。以下是几种常见的日志分析技术:
基于规则的日志分析技术:通过预设规则,对日志数据进行筛选和分析。
基于统计的日志分析技术:通过统计方法,对日志数据进行挖掘和分析。
基于机器学习的日志分析技术:利用机器学习算法,对日志数据进行分类和分析。
四、流量监控技术
流量监控技术是网络监控的重要组成部分,通过对网络流量的实时监控,可以了解网络运行状况,发现潜在的安全问题。以下是几种常见的流量监控技术:
深度包检测技术:通过对数据包的深度解析,识别恶意流量。
流量分类技术:根据流量特征,对网络流量进行分类。
流量监控平台:如Prometheus、Zabbix等,实现对网络流量的实时监控。
案例分析:
以某企业网络监控为例,该企业采用入侵检测技术、数据包捕获技术和日志分析技术,实现了对网络安全的全面监控。通过入侵检测技术,及时发现并阻止了针对企业网络的攻击;通过数据包捕获技术,发现了网络异常流量,有效降低了网络攻击风险;通过日志分析技术,发现了系统漏洞,及时进行了修复。
总结:
网络监控方案的关键技术包括入侵检测技术、数据包捕获技术、日志分析技术和流量监控技术。通过合理运用这些技术,可以有效保障网络安全,为企业提供稳定、可靠的网络环境。
猜你喜欢:eBPF